Hi, I was just wondering if there's a difference in the evaluation between expressions like tan (2pi/3) and tan (-2pi/3)? Or any expressions like that, especially when on the unit circle (or at least in my book), there's no "-2pi/3", only "2pi/3". Thanks.

Here they are:
sin(theta) = -sin(-theta)
cos(theta) = cos(-theta)
tan(theta) = -tan(-theta)
